Arcutis director Terrie Curran sells $956k in shares

Arcutis Biotherapeutics director Terrie Curran divested $956,122 worth of company shares on August 27, 2026. The sale comprised 38,200 shares, divided into two transactions. In the first, Curran offloaded 11,148 shares at an average price of $25.0294, generating proceeds of $279,027. The second transaction saw the sale of 27,052 shares, also at the same weighted average price, yielding $677,095 in revenue.

The shares traded within a $25.00 to $25.1001 price bracket, representing a premium over the stock's current price of $23.78, which InvestingPro analysis deems undervalued. Prior to these sales, Curran had bought the same quantity of shares through stock option exercises. Upon exercising those options, she acquired 11,148 shares at $7.51 per share, costing $83,721, and another 27,052 shares at $8.63 each, totaling $233,458.

After these transactions, Curran holds 23,526 shares of Arcutis common stock. Additionally, Arcutis Biotherapeutics reported a robust second-quarter 2026 revenue of $129.9 million, surpassing analyst estimates and marking a significant increase from both the previous year and the preceding quarter.

This growth, largely attributed to the successful sales of their product Zoryve, has propelled the company into profitability. Following these results, Guggenheim raised its price target for Arcutis from $35 to $38, citing solid sales performance and pricing improvements.
